Wealth Enhancement Advisory Services LLC lowered its position in Leggett & Platt, Incorporated (NYSE:LEG - Free Report) by 35.5% in the first qu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The fund owned 54,227 shares of the company's stock after selling 29,876 shares during the period. Wealth Enhancement Advisory Services LLC's holdings in Leggett & Platt were worth $429,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Leggett & Platt (NYSE:LEG -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Monday, April 28th. The company reported $0.24 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.23 by $0.01. The firm had revenue of $1.02 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.02 billion. Leggett & Platt had a negative net margin of 11.89% and a positive return on equity of 20.46%. The company's revenue for the quarter was down 6.8%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the business earned $0.23 EPS. As a group, analysts forecast that Leggett & Platt, Incorporated will post 1.14 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Leggett & Platt Company Profile

Leggett & Platt, Inc engages in the manufacture and distribution of furniture and engineered components and products among homes, offices, automobiles, and commercial aircraft. It operates through the following segments: Bedding Products, Specialized Products, and Furniture, Flooring & Textile Products.
